Section 103 Obviousness Analysis (PHOSITA)
Field of Art
Materials engineering, specifically titanium powder metallurgy, advanced manufacturing techniques for metallic components, and precision engineering for high-performance materials used in timepieces and ornamental applications
Person of Ordinary Skill (PHOSITA) Profile
A materials engineer with expertise in powder metallurgy, advanced manufacturing processes, and materials characterization, holding a master's or PhD in materials science or metallurgical engineering, with 5-10 years of industrial experience in titanium alloy development and processing
Obviousness Rationale
A person having ordinary skill in the art would recognize that the published technical disclosure represents predictable extensions of the source patent's core titanium sintering technology by applying standard engineering techniques of sensor integration, advanced manufacturing optimization, and material enhancement to the existing titanium sintered body framework.
